"Image quality is still excellent, with a usable ISO range of 80-800 and fast f/2.0 maximum aperture, albeit only at the wide-angle lens setting, making the S95 very well-suited to low-light, hand-held photography."
photographyblog.com | talking about the S95's iso-noise
"Something that was glaringly missing from the S90 - HD video capture - has been rectified on the S95, with 720p movies at 1280x720 pixels resolution available at 24fps complete with stereo sound."
photographyblog.com | talking about the S95's video-quality

Advantages of the Canon S95

Sensor size Much larger sensor 1/1.7" 7.6x5.7mm vs 1/2.3" 6.2x4.6mm
Help
More than 50% larger sensor
Supports 24p Supports 24p Yes vs No
Help
Get that real film feel
Aperture Wider aperture f/2.0 vs f/2.4
Help
At its widest zoom, the S95's lens captures slightly more light (0.5 f-stops)
Supports RAW Shoots RAW Yes vs No
Help
Digitally develop your own photos with precise image control
HDR Has in-camera HDR Yes vs No
Help
Combines multiple exposures to capture high dynamic range
Screen size Larger screen 3.0" vs 2.8"
Help
Around 10% larger screen
Light sensitivity (boost) Has boost ISO 12,800 ISO vs None
Help
Allows taking photos in darker situations, often at the cost of additional noise in the image
True resolution Slightly higher true resolution 10 MP vs 9.8 MP
Help
Almost the same
Longest exposure Longer exposures 15s vs 2s
Help
7.5x longer exposures

Advantages of the Sony DSC-WX5

Movie format Higher resolution movies 1080p @ 30fps vs 720p @ 24fps
Help
Shoots higher resolution Full HD (1080p) video at a higher frame rate
Wide angle Significantly better wide angle 24 mm vs 28 mm
Help
More than 10% better wide angle
Size Significantly smaller 92x52x22 mm vs 99x58x29 mm
Help
Around 40% smaller
Sensor type Has a CMOS-family sensor CMOS vs CCD
Help
CMOS-family sensors often produce better quality images
Continuous shooting Shoots significantly faster 10 fps vs 1.9 fps
Help
Around 5.5x faster continuous shooting
Thickness Significantly thinner 0.9" vs 1.2"
Help
Around 30% thinner
Weight Significantly lighter 146 g vs 193 g
Help
More than 20% lighter
Zoom Slightly more zoom 5x vs 3.8x
Help
Around 80% more zoom
Shutter lag Slightly less shutter lag 320 ms vs 610 ms
Help
Around 50% less delay when taking photos
Lowest price Cheaper $230.00 vs $340.00
Help
The best price we've seen is $110 cheaper (more than 30% less)
